Output 4aec628b935e739b7ac828a04f7ae9a5f6891bb14fc5705997f508d917ad7e42:0

value
29658300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 288adc752eaf4e7bfd038953e142cd171586f8e8 OP_EQUAL
address
MBbXcM2jVmxtsZjV4rqFj23zWnYurWuBG3
transaction
4aec628b935e739b7ac828a04f7ae9a5f6891bb14fc5705997f508d917ad7e42
spent
true